Diadochi Kings

Diadochi Kings is a complete overhaul mod for CK2. As the name suggests, it (initially) takes place following the death of Alexander the Great and focuses on the following wars in the Mediterranean. Possible future scenarios include Cyrus the Great, Philip of Macedon, and many more!

Diadochi Kings 0.010 for CKII v3.3.0
Download: https://www.moddb.com/mods/diadochi-kings-for-crusader-kings-2/downloads/diadochi-kings-v0010

List of features:
  • Brand new map that covers the Mediterranean and Near East by shifting south-east from the Vanilla game's map.
  • All new characters, titles, religions, and cultures.
  • New events, decisions, and buildings to bring the ancient world to life.
  • New features that will add unprecedented historical accuracy.

Installation instructions:(ignore if using Steam Workshop)
If you already have an earlier version of DK, delete it.
Open up the .zip file and place the contents in <Documents\Paradox Interactive\Crusader Kings II\mod.
If the <mod> folder doesn't exist yet, create it.

FAQ:
  • The CKII Engine doesn't allow negative dates, what's your workaround for this?
    • This mod uses 776 BC as the year 0 as that was (presumably) the year the first Olympic games were hosted.
  • Can I help you make the mod?
    • Of course you can! Send me a PM if you want to help us out.
